Why These Are the Top GMC Repair Auto Repair Shops in Avon

The GMC repair market in Avon, Connecticut, is characterized by high-quality, specialized service providers catering to an affluent demographic that commonly owns Denali models and heavy-duty trucks. The competition is strong but not oversaturated, with a clear tiered structure: * **The Dealership (Gengras):** Serves as the benchmark for OEM-standard repairs, especially for complex electronics and warranty work. Pricing is at a premium but offers peace of mind with factory parts and direct technical support. * **High-End Independents (Avon Imports & Domestic):** These shops compete directly with the dealership on diagnostic capability and service quality, often at a 15-25% lower labor rate. They succeed by offering more personalized service and expertise on older models. * **Truck & SUV Specialists (J.T's Automotive):** Fill a crucial niche for owners who use their GMCs for heavy towing, plowing, or off-road purposes. Their strength lies in mechanical and suspension work that dealerships may sublet out. Typical pricing reflects the area's cost of living, with dealership labor rates likely exceeding $175/hour and reputable independents ranging from $140-$165/hour. Customers in this market demonstrate high expectations for both technical competence and customer service.

What are the most common GMC repair issues for drivers in Avon, CT?

In Avon, common issues include suspension wear from local road conditions like Route 44 and I-84, as well as brake system maintenance due to hilly terrain. GMC trucks and SUVs also frequently need attention for electrical components in infotainment systems and HVAC blower motors, which are known service points for many models.

How can I find a reputable, specialized GMC repair shop in the Avon area?

Look for shops in Avon or nearby Farmington Valley towns that are ASE-certified and have specific GMC or GM diagnostic tooling, like a genuine Tech2 or MDI. Checking for membership in the Connecticut Automotive Trades Association (CATA) and reading local reviews about experiences with Sierra or Acadia models can also identify true specialists.

When should I seek service for my GMC versus going to the dealership in Hartford?

Seek a local independent specialist for routine maintenance, older model year repairs, or after-warranty work to often save on labor rates. For complex warranty-covered repairs, software recalls, or specific new-model diagnostics, the Hartford-area dealership may be necessary due to proprietary programming tools.

How does Avon's climate affect my GMC's maintenance schedule?

Connecticut's seasonal extremes require specific attention. Prioritize battery testing before winter, as cold strains starting systems, and ensure 4WD/AWD servicing for winter traction. Also, schedule thorough undercarriage inspections in spring to address corrosion from road salt used on Avon roads.
